This variable will give you a total number of fields in the current input record. awk -F',' '{print NF}' file.csv Example: $ cat file.csv col1,col2,col3,col4 col1,col2,col3 col1,col2 col1 col1,col2,col3,col4,col5 $ awk -F',' '{print NF}' file.csv 4 3 2 1 5

F#, like most programming languages, uses Strict Evaluation by default. In Strict Evaluation, computations are executed immediately.
